The Core i9-12900K is manufactured by Intel. It was released in 4 November 2021 (4 years ago). It is based on the Alder Lake, Golden Cove, Gracemont (2021) architecture. It features 16 cores and 24 threads. Base frequency is 3.2 GHz, with boost up to 5.2 GHz. L3 cache: 30 MB (total). L2 cache: 1.25 MB (per core). Built on 10 nm process technology. Socket: LGA1700. Thermal design power (TDP): 125 Watt. Memory support: DDR4, DDR5. Passmark benchmark score: 41,180 points. Launch price was $589.

Intel

Xeon Gold 6258R

The Xeon Gold 6258R is manufactured by Intel. It was released in 24 February 2020 (5 years ago). It is based on the Cascade Lake (2019−2020) architecture. It features 28 cores and 56 threads. Base frequency is 2.7 GHz, with boost up to 4 GHz. L3 cache: 38.5 MB. L2 cache: 28 MB.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 205 Watt. Memory support: DDR4-2933. Passmark benchmark score: 40,442 points. Launch price was $3,950.

Memory & Platform

The Core i9-12900K uses the LGA1700 socket (PCIe 5.0), while the Xeon Gold 6258R uses LGA3647 (PCIe 3.0)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R5-4800 on the Core i9-12900K versus 2933 on the Xeon Gold 6258R — the Core i9-12900K supports 63.7%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Xeon Gold 6258R supports up to 1024 GB of RAM compared to 128 GB 700% more capacity for professional workloads. Memory channels: 2 (Core i9-12900K) vs 6 (Xeon Gold 6258R). PCIe lanes: 20 (Core i9-12900K) vs 48 (Xeon Gold 6258R) — the Xeon Gold 6258R offers 28 more lanes for additional GPUs or NVMe drives. Chipset compatibility: Intel 600 series,Intel 700 series (Core i9-12900K) and LGA3647 (Xeon Gold 6258R).
